There were a lot of weird double cutaways Les Pauls made in the 80's, sometimes with odd PU configurations (for Gibson) like one HB and two single coils, and factory locking trems. The bodies sometimes had binding, sometimes not, and some looked more like Melody Makers than Les Pauls. The important thing for me is that they had Explorer style headstocks.

I'm looking for one with the more LP or LP Special type body, double cutaway, with binding preferred. I don't care too much about the pickup config or whether it has a trem on it.
